It takes 27 pounds of seed to completely plant a 3-acre field. How many pounds of seed are needed per acre?

Answer:

9 pounds of seed per acre.

Step-by-step explanation:

All you have to do is division.  It takes 27 pounds of seed to make 3 acres, so 27 divided by 3.  That gives you 9.
